Frequently Asked Questions

How much does laser hair removal cost in Freeland, WA?

In Freeland, laser hair removal typically costs between $150 and $400 per session, depending on the area treated. Many local clinics on Whidbey Island offer package discounts for multiple sessions, which can provide better long-term value.

Are there any reputable laser hair removal clinics near Freeland, WA?

Yes, while Freeland itself has limited options, residents can access reputable clinics in nearby towns like Langley, Oak Harbor, or Clinton on Whidbey Island. Some providers also serve the South Whidbey area with mobile or appointment-based services.

What should I look for in a laser hair removal provider in the Freeland area?

Look for providers on Whidbey Island who use FDA-approved lasers and have certified technicians. It's also helpful to choose a clinic with experience treating various skin types common in the Pacific Northwest, and many offer free consultations to discuss your specific needs.

How many laser hair removal sessions are typically needed for effective results in Freeland?

Most people in the Freeland area require 6-8 sessions spaced 4-6 weeks apart for optimal results, due to hair growth cycles. Factors like hair color, thickness, and the treatment area can affect the exact number needed, which a local consultant can assess.

Is laser hair removal safe for all skin types in Freeland's climate?

Yes, modern lasers used by reputable providers near Freeland are generally safe for most skin types. However, it's important to disclose any sun exposure or tanning, common in Washington's summers, as this can affect treatment safety and timing—clinics often recommend treatments in fall or winter for best results.

Electrolysis works by using a tiny probe to apply a small electrical current to each individual hair follicle, destroying its ability to regrow. This precision makes it ideal for treating any hair color or skin type, including the finer facial hair common in our temperate marine climate. When looking for electrolysis services in Freeland, consider practitioners who are licensed and certified by the American Electrology Association. Unlike some laser treatments that require specific hair pigments, electrolysis can handle gray, blonde, and red hairs common in our population. This is particularly valuable as we age or experience seasonal sun lightening. Practical tips for your search: Ask about numbing options for comfort, inquire about package pricing for multiple sessions, and check if the clinic uses modern galvanic or thermolysis technology.
